Cost of Paved Walkway Construction in Norwalk

Constructing a paved walkway in Norwalk, CT, can enhance the aesthetic appeal and functionality of your outdoor space. Whether you're planning a simple path through your garden or a more elaborate walkway, understanding the costs involved is crucial for budgeting and planning.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Material Choice: The type of paving material selected, such as concrete, brick, or natural stone, significantly impacts the overall cost.
  • Walkway Size: Larger walkways require more materials and labor, increasing the total expense.
  • Design Complexity: Intricate designs and patterns necessitate more time and expertise, thus raising costs.
  • Site Preparation: The condition of the site, including grading and excavation needs, can influence the cost.
  •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Norwalk, CT, can vary, affecting the final price.
  • Permits and Regulations: Compliance with local building codes and obtaining necessary permits can add to the cost.
  • Additional Features: Incorporating elements like lighting, edging, or drainage systems will increase the overall cost.

Common Tasks and Costs

Task Average Cost (Norwalk, CT)
Basic Concrete Walkway $6 - $10 per square foot
Brick Paver Walkway $10 - $20 per square foot
Natural Stone Walkway $15 - $30 per square foot
Excavation and Site Prep $1,000 - $3,000
Design and Planning $500 - $1,500
Installation of Edging $5 - $10 per linear foot
Adding Lighting Features $50 - $150 per fixture
Permit Fees $100 - $500

Understanding these factors and average costs can help you make informed decisions when planning your paved walkway project in Norwalk, CT.
